Most units at this time turn into out of date not due to put on and tear or injury, however from a lack of software program help. The norm up till a number of years in the past was for 2 to 3 years of OS updates, however Google and Samsung are altering that.
Mountain View-based Google was first to formally prolong help for its flagships in 2023, asserting that the Pixel 8 collection can have seven years of assured Android OS and safety updates till October 2030. What was stunning was that Google prolonged the identical help to its mid-range Pixel 8a as properly, marking a significant change in our expectations of the tech large.
Samsung adopted go well with by asserting seven years of OS and safety updates for the S24, S24+ and S24 Extremely, with the Galaxy Z Flip 6 and Fold 6 gaining the identical help.

Google’s newest Pixel 9 collection, as anticipated, additionally provides prolonged OS and safety updates, properly into 2031, however that is not the tech large’s finish purpose. It desires extra smartphones and their consumers to learn with seven years of updates.
As highlighted by Mishaal Rahman in a report for Android Authority, the tech large desires to make it simpler for different OEMs to supply seven years of updates for his or her units, and it’s doing so with the Longevity Google Necessities Freeze (LGRF).
For reference, again in 2020, Google launched GRF, which primarily laid down the groundwork for longer help that we’re having fun with at this time. The requirement freeze made it simpler for chip producers like Qualcomm and MediaTek to help a number of OS iterations with a single chipset. This ensured that chip distributors did not have to replace vendor-side software program for a minimum of three iterations of Android.

LGRF primarily permits the identical chipset vendor-side software program to be repurposed for seven Android model updates, up from three. Which means a tool that launches with Android 15 can probably obtain updates as much as Android 22 (if the naming scheme stays constant) with out requiring important software program commitments from the chip vendor’s facet.
Beneath this system, for the primary three years, the seller’s software program will stay frozen, although OEMs might want to replace the Linux kernel after three years with the intention to obtain Google’s certification, guaranteeing well timed safety patches. Qualcomm’s recently-announced Snapdragon 8 Elite is the primary chipset beneath LRGF.
Whereas this system does have apparent advantages, like longer lifespans for a bigger subset of units, it has drawbacks and limitations too. For instance, one limitation in place is that OEMs cannot ship a tool with an Android model that’s 4 updates forward of its chip’s authentic vendor software program. For instance, Snapdragon 8 Elite’s vendor software program, designed for Android 15, cannot be straight used on a tool that’s launching with Android 19. That is to forestall producers from delivery units that may solely profit from three OS updates.
Additional, some options down the road may require updates to the seller software program regardless, which might make vendor software program frozen at a selected construct incapable of supporting stated new options.
Google hasn’t publicly shared particulars about LGRF. Rahman means that the tech large held an occasion for OEMs earlier within the yr, and that is how we find out about Google’s Longevity Necessities Freeze plans.
